Factors to Consider When Choosing Vr Headset For Comfort Out Of The Box

Choosing a VR headset for comfort out of the box involves more than just looking at specs. It’s crucial to consider how the design interacts with your head shape, how lightweight the headset is, and whether it has sufficient padding. Pay attention to the balance of the device, as a poorly balanced headset can cause fatigue quickly. Adjustability features can enhance comfort but are less useful if the headset isn’t inherently comfortable when first worn. Finally, think about the duration of your typical sessions—longer use demands lighter, more ergonomic designs to prevent strain.

Weight and Balance

Lightweight headsets tend to cause less fatigue, especially during longer play sessions. Balance is equally important; a headset that sits well on your head without tipping forward or backward improves comfort immediately. Heavier devices or those with uneven weight distribution can lead to neck strain, making even the most advanced specs less relevant if comfort is sacrificed from the start.

Padding and Fit

Pre-installed padding that conforms well to your head shape is key to out-of-the-box comfort. Look for models with adjustable straps and replaceable padding options, which help customize the fit without hassle. Poor padding can cause pressure points and discomfort, especially around the forehead and cheeks, so quality materials and thoughtful design matter greatly.

Design Ergonomics

Ergonomic design involves more than just padding; it’s about how the headset contours around your head and face. Some models feature curved, lightweight frames that distribute pressure evenly, reducing hotspots. A well-designed headset that feels natural to wear will be more comfortable during quick sessions and prolonged use alike.

Adjustability and Ease of Use

While adjustability features such as straps and face padding help fine-tune the fit, the best headsets for immediate comfort require minimal tweaking. An intuitive, simple setup process that doesn’t require tools or complex adjustments is ideal for those eager to start using the device comfortably right away.

Long-Term Comfort Considerations

Design choices that reduce weight and optimize balance also support longer-term comfort. Ventilation and foam materials that prevent overheating or sweating can enhance the experience, especially during extended gameplay. Recognizing that comfort is subjective, selecting a headset with a well-thought-out ergonomic profile ensures less fatigue over time, even if initial unboxing feels perfect.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I make a heavy VR headset comfortable without modifications?

While some heavier headsets can be made more comfortable with accessories like padding or counterweights, out-of-the-box comfort is primarily determined by the device’s design. Headsets with balanced weight distribution and quality padding naturally feel more comfortable without adjustments. If you want immediate comfort, choosing a lightweight, ergonomically designed model is your best bet, as modifications can only do so much to compensate for inherent design limitations.

Are adjustable straps enough to guarantee comfort straight away?

Adjustable straps significantly improve fit, but they don’t compensate for poor padding or bulky design. Even with perfect strap adjustments, a headset that is inherently heavy or poorly balanced may still cause discomfort. For immediate comfort without adjustments, look for models that are designed with ergonomic contours and high-quality padding that fit well without needing much tweaking.

How important is weight compared to padding for comfort?

Both weight and padding are vital, but weight often has a more immediate impact on comfort—lighter headsets tend to cause less fatigue during short to moderate sessions. Padding enhances comfort for longer use by reducing pressure points. Ideally, a headset should combine both features: lightweight with well-designed padding for the best out-of-the-box experience.

Should I prioritize a lightweight headset if I plan long VR sessions?

Yes, a lightweight headset greatly reduces fatigue during extended use, making it more comfortable to wear over long periods. However, weight isn’t the only factor; good padding and proper fit are equally important. Balancing all these aspects will ensure you enjoy longer sessions without discomfort or strain.

What common mistakes do buyers make when choosing a comfortable VR headset?

Many buyers focus solely on technical specs or price, overlooking the importance of ergonomic design and comfort features. They often underestimate how weight, padding, and balance affect immediate wearability. Another mistake is assuming adjustability alone guarantees comfort; the initial fit and design quality are critical. Reading reviews that mention comfort specifically can help avoid these pitfalls.
